On Thu, Mar 14, 2013 at 5:28 PM, Danny Kurniawan < danny.kurniawan@fairchildsemi.com> wrote:
Thanks a lot for your reply.
Yes i got it working. However one more question :
what is the operator used to check if the value is empty ?
if(control:Calling-Station-Id == ""){ reject }
*not working for above
Not sure. Maybe
if( !("%{control:Calling-Station-Id}") ){ reject }
